About This Item

London: Duckworth, 1923. 1st Edition . Hardcover. Good. First edition. Hardback, bound in red cloth with printed black titling to the spine and upper board. 19 × 12.5cm, 327pp. A Lost Civilization novel. A lost race descended from Alexandrian Greeks dwell in a hidden valley of the Himalayas, and they have special powers... Condition: A good reading copy. The red cloth is dulled and a bit grubby, the pages slightly tanned but the inner binding secure and in strong readable condition.
